This podcast is episode 1 of 2 featuring singer and song collector Chris Lawley. An eclectic mix of traditional folk, English music hall and First World War soldiers' songs from the mid 19th to early 20th century.

Chris has made sporadic appearances in folk clubs down the years but serious interest in traditional folk music is a relatively recent development. The subsequent discovery of music hall produced another rich source of songs, then the 100th anniversary of the beginning of World War 1 gave further inspiration and material.

Chris and his younger brother Mark (also featured in this podcast) have been making a name for themselves as the uniformed duo The Pals who re-enact 'trench songs' about soldiers' experiences. The gallows humour found in these songs is part of the coping mechanism necessary on those hellish battlefields.
